An atom of nitrogen has 5 electrons in its outer shell. This makes nitrogen a nonmetal and means it requires 3 more electrons to fill its outer shell and become stable.
The most stable atom is one that has a full outer electron shell, called a valence shell. Atoms achieve stability by gaining, losing, or sharing electrons to fill their valence shell. Additionally, atoms with a balanced number of protons and neutrons in the nucleus tend to be more stable.
In a covalent bond, each atom retains its outer shell of electrons. The atoms share pairs of electrons to achieve a full outer shell, which makes the bond stable.

The shell of the egg will dissolve and the egg can bounce on a small height. This is because the lemon juice, which is an acid reacts with the calcium carbonate and dissolves it.

Ingredients1 c Sugar3 tb Cornstarch1 tb Lemon rind; grated1/4 c Butter (or marg.)1/4 c Lemon juice1 c Milk3 Egg yolks; slightly beaten1 c Sour cream1 Pastry shell (9 ); bakedCream; whipped Lemon rind; grated (opt.) Combine sugar, cornstarch, 1 tablespoon lemon rind, butter, lemon juice, milk, and egg yolks in a heavy saucepan. Cook over medium heat unitl smooth and thickend, stirring constantly; cover and cool. Fold sour cream into filling, and pour inot pastry shell; chill at least 2 hours before serving. Top with whipped cream; garnish with grated lemon rind, if desired.

No, conchs do not change shells as they grow. They continue to live in the same shell throughout their lifespan, with their shell growing along with them. If their shell becomes damaged or too small, they can repair or remodel it.
